A list of changes made in Nitrome Games after they were released.

B.C. Bow ContestEdit

  • The Fire Cup and Tar Cup were added.

Cave ChaosEdit

  • As a player would run through the cave, there used to be bats that would help put the platform together of which the player would run across, but some time later in the year, they were mysteriously removed. Nitrome re-added the bats on July 25th 2011.

Double EdgedEdit

  • The priest of hecate was changed to the earl of hecate for unknown reasons, but in some parts of the game retained its original name "priest of hecate".

Enemy 585Edit

  • After getting several emails about adding Checkpoints to the game, Nitrome added them in November.

Ice Breaker: The GatheringEdit

  • After all the levels were released, Nitrome added a feature where the player could continue onto the next set of levels after completing the final level for a clan. Eventually, they also added the ending to the game.

Nitrome Must DieEdit

  • After some time of the game's release, Nitrome edited the amount of damage that the barrel gun does so that it would be much stronger.

Rubble TroubleEdit

  • Nitrome changed Rubble Trouble into Rubble Trouble New York with a different main menu background, and two new levels.

RushEdit

  • Nitrome fixed a bug.

Test Subject ArenaEdit

  • Nitrome made it easier to defeat the other player with the melee attack. Before, a player could duck in the corner and keep shooting, making it very difficult for him/her to be defeated.

Test Subject BlueEdit

  • Nitrome let people submit their scores at the end of the game.

Tiny CastleEdit

Twin Shot 2Edit

  • Skins were added after a short time.

Skywire VIP ExtendedEdit

  • 'My neighbour Totoro' was removed because of the difference in spelling in the UK and the US. The UK/Canadian spelling added a u between o and r ("My neighbour Totoro"), while the US spelling dropped the u. As Nitrome is British, they retained the u. However, the British spelling caused much confusion between the US spelling of the word (the commonly used spelling), as a large percentage of Nitrome's fans would probably be used to the US spelling.
